G. Wayne DuBose passed away Dec. 6, 2011 after a strong battle with cancer.

He was born Dec. 16, 1944 in New Brockton, Ala. After service with the USMC, he pursued a career in aviation maintenance. In 1974, he moved to Fayetteville, Ga., and began work with Delta Airlines, retiring in 2005 as an Aircraft Inspection foreman. Much of his retirement was spent enjoying vegetable gardening, long daily bicycle rides, poker and occasional trips ‘back home’ or to North Georgia.

He leaves behind, his wife, Becky Bartels; daughter, Margo DuBose and husband Rick Grzembski of Fayetteville; son, John and Crystal DuBose of Griffin; grandchildren – Gabriel and Sophia Grzembski and Victoria DuBose; sister Carolyn Clark of Phenix City, Ala. along with beloved neighbors, extended family, former classmates and work friends.
